Shipping Nation wide 2-4 working days Features & Details Efficient Slicing: Powered by a robust 200W motor and operating at 70–100 RPM, this home meat slicer ensures smooth, efficient cutting. It delivers uniformly sliced meat in less time, eliminating the risk of uneven, unsafe manual cuts and streamlining your meal prep Dual Blades for Versatile Cutting: Includes both a 7.5-inch (190mm) stainless steel serrated blade and a non-serrated blade, providing smooth and adaptable slicing for a wide variety of foods. Easily handle frozen meat, deli items, steak, ham, baguettes, carrots, potatoes, and more Adjustable Thickness: Featuring a simple thickness adjustment knob, this electric slicer lets you customize slices from 0 to 0.6 inches (0–15mm). Whether you need thin deli slices or thicker cuts, it adapts easily to your specific food preparation needs Easy to Clean: The blade, food pusher, and slide bar extender are all removable for a thorough cleaning. The reversible meat tray design also allows you to easily wipe down the entire unit, making maintenance quick and hassle-free Safe & Stable Use: Featuring a 1 mm recessed blade, a food pusher for safer slicing, and strong suction cup feet for stability, this semi-automatic slicer provides secure and reliable operation. Compact, lightweight, and easy to store - an ideal fit for any home kitchen
